Is the penis air pump a temporary device ?

Yes.: The penis pump, or vacuum-erection device (ved), draws blood into the penis to aid in producing an erection. The blood is kept in the penis to maintain the erection by applying a flexible ring at the base of the penis. This ring is removed after intercourse, allowing the blood to return to the body.
